Course Description

In today’s digital-first world, organizations face evolving IT risks that can impact operations, regulatory compliance, and reputation. IT Risks and Controls: A Primer equips learners with foundational knowledge of IT risk management and control frameworks. Participants will explore key IT risks, effective assessment techniques, and strategies to implement preventive, detective, and corrective controls. By understanding stakeholder roles, governance frameworks like NIST and COBIT, and real-world case studies, learners will develop the skills to identify, assess, and mitigate IT risks effectively.

Learning Objectives
  • Recognize IT risks and classify them into operational, strategic, compliance, and financial categories.
  • Identify and implement IT control types (preventive, detective, corrective, and directive) to manage risks effectively.
  • Discover the fundamental components of IT control frameworks such as COBIT, ISO/IEC 27001, and the NIST Cybersecurity Framework to ensure IT governance and compliance.
